The Window of Tolerance is a practical framework for understanding how your nervous system responds to stress, conflict, and emotional overwhelm. This guide explains the difference between hyperarousal (feeling anxious, reactive, or overwhelmed) and hypoarousal (feeling shut down, numb, or disconnected), and how both can affect communication and relationships.

When you are within your window, you are more able to think clearly, stay present, and respond with intention. Outside of it, your nervous system shifts into survival mode, making it harder to listen, reflect, or stay connected.

This resource helps you recognise early warning signs, understand your own patterns, and make more grounded decisions in the moment. It also introduces simple ways to pause, regulate, and return to a state where meaningful communication is possible.
